How does Rumble actually work?

Is there any info regarding what it actually does. I have a youtube channel and I want to post a video on here, so would I still make money off the video from youtube? and make more off this site when I post the same video? What is the pay split with Rumble?

thanks for any assistance or direction on this.
If you want to take part in the discussions click the Connect in the top right!